Chapter 1: Noticing Her

It has been over two weeks since he noticed her. Everyday he would watch her sit in the same spot near the window, order a Chocolate Frappuccino, stir its contents and in exactly 15 minutes finish drinking the cup. Yes, he even counted and stared at his watch. Everything about her seemed so perfect and flawless.

He was merely interested in this ningen, and nothing more. At least that's what his mind made him believe. From day to day he would quietly observe her from the corner of the coffee shop. He would slowly sip his black Brazilian coffee and watch her every move with detail. But he failed to see the thin mahogany stick that was leaning against her chair. How can one be so blind yet so observing?

The young man cursed inwardly when he looked at the silver watched strapped around his left wrist. Fifteen past eight, it read and in another fifteen minutes be would be facing a flock of annoying old geezers along with bimbos that knew nothing.

He took another glance at the young lady before finishing his coffee in one gulp and giving her a silent goodbye.

I'll see you tomorrow beautiful.

She felt a gust of wind pass her and a strand of hair tickling her face before it was gone just as fast as it came. She resumed back to drinking her Frap, taking note of the smell it lingered behind. Light cologne with a natural smell of warmth.
